What is PASCAM Bea?

PASCAM Bea is based on the logical development of the semantic feature technology of PASCAM WoodWorks. It provides the designer with all the typical, woodworking CNC features - in addition to the common SOLIDWORKS® geometry features - in order to be able to model woodworking products in a comprehensive, manufacturing-oriented way, strictly following the "designed for manufacturing" (DFM) approach. PASCAM Bea is fully and seamlessly integrated into SOLIDWORKS®, and works closely with the woodworking CAD-engineering solution PASCAM Woodworks.

Together with PASCAM Woodworks it is possible to create an integrated CAx chain, starting with the modelling and design process, the subsequent determination of accounting and billing, the optional drawing export and BOM list generation and finally right up to the CNC programming, all based on the same SOLIDWORKS® 3D model.

By integrating our woodworking CAD/CAM system in the market-leading, feature-based 3D-CAD system SOLIDWORKS®, PASCAM is providing advanced "design for manufacturing" methods in woodworking. This manufacturing-oriented modeling along the entire process chain from design to manufacturing, is ensuring reliable data integration, helping to avoid costly mistakes and achieve significant time savings.
